About This Camp

This is Cal Poly San Luis Obispo's 2026 Youth Day Camps Session #2, a five-day coed day clinic running July 27–31 in San Luis Obispo, California. The camp costs $325 and is designed for ages 5–12 to learn fundamental soccer skills and introduce players to a fun, supportive environment. All skill levels are welcome.

This is a youth development camp, not a college recruiting event. The coed format at a school with separate NCAA men's and women's programs, combined with the age range (5–12), confirms this is designed for recreational and foundational skill-building rather than high school or college ID evaluation. Families should understand they are signing their younger children up for a summer soccer clinic run by a Division 1 program, not an event where recruiting conversations will happen.

Expect day-camp logistics: players attend sessions during daytime hours and return home each evening. The focus is on fundamentals, enjoyment, and introducing players to structured soccer coaching. Because the head coach does not attend and this is a youth-focused clinic, coaching will likely come from assistant staff or graduate assistants rather than the college program's top recruiting personnel. The $325 fee is moderate for a five-day college-hosted camp. There are no existing reviews to reference.

This camp is a good fit for families with young children (elementary school age) looking for a quality summer soccer experience at a college facility. It's not a recruiting venue and should not be approached as one. If you're the parent of a high school or middle school player seeking college ID evaluation, look for age-appropriate recruiting camps instead.
